I have biked the Harlem Valley Rail Trail in NYS a few times. You can take a bicycle from NYC on a just over 2 hour train ride to Wassaic, NY then bike 20 miles north to the end in Copake Falls, NY where you will find a short walking trail to Bash Bish Falls in Massachusetts.
